Under the Microscope: Mr. Mohsen Armin's Resignation and Remarks in the Islamic Consultative Assembly - 2004-03-15. Dr. Alireza Noori Zadeh, a journalist and political analyst residing in London, answers questions from a reporter of the Persian section of Voice of America regarding the following issues: 1 - Mr. Mohsen Armin's resignation and remarks in the Islamic Consultative Assembly 2 - Discussions between officials of the Mo'talefeh Party of Iran and members of the Politburo of the Communist Party of China.
